Posting here as I can't help but imagine it's a GNOME issue on some level...

When I'm in Thunderbird (current release, Jaunty) and click Write or Reply, the message composition windows opens in the foreground, but DOES NOT HAVE FOCUS!

This is really annoying if you're going to start your e-mail with a capital C and all of a sudden you've marked all your messages as read, because the inbox had focus and shift + c is the keyboard shortcut for mark all as read...
